History buffs will appreciate the National Museum of the Pacific War, a tribute to the town’s notable son, Admiral Nimitz. Nature enthusiasts can’t miss the dramatic beauty of Enchanted Rock State Natural Area, perfect for hiking or picnicking with awe-inspiring views.
Fredericksburg is equally famous for its thriving wine scene, boasting over fifty wineries and vineyards that pepper the surrounding hills. That means plenty of opportunity for sampling local wines and unwinding under the big Texas sky.

Known for landmarks like the Arlington National Cemetery and the Iwo Jima Memorial, this town invites you to reflect and connect with the past while enjoying its present-day wonders.
If you're a fan of the arts, the Signature Theatre offers captivating performances that might just inspire your next creative venture. Prefer a dose of fresh air? Wander through the beautiful gardens at the National Arboretum or head to Theodore Roosevelt Island for a peaceful nature walk.
